  • @Skatie

    @Skatie

    Жыл бұрын

    You may need to loosen your trucks as suggested. If you stand in your skates do you have movement left and right by leaning on your big then little toe? If not you will have trouble getting your edges and need to loosen your trucks. Do it slowly as it can be very easy to make them too loose. 1/4 turn at a time.

  • @Skatie

    @Skatie

    Жыл бұрын

    Hi. Rookie’s webaite suggest the following sizes. Hope this helps. • 5/16" / 8mm - Socket for Mounting hardware. • 1/2" / 13mm - Socket for Wheel nuts. • 9/16" / 14mm - Socket for Kingpin nuts. • 1/8" Allen key • Phillips Screwdriver

    How do I know if the truck needs loosening or tightening ?

  • @Skatie

    @Skatie

    Жыл бұрын

    If you’re putting pressure on the big toe and little toe the skates should lean. If they’re not leaning they are too tight, if they waggle about and lean very easily then you probably need to tighten them
